While Christmas shopping, Kathy Bartlett's car
overheats along an isolated stretch of I-95 in New York.
The hairdresser concludes that cars and men are alike as
both overheat at the wrong time. As she starts to freeze,
she grabs a toy she dubbed Peter and wishes she was
somewhere else, preferably warm. The next thing Kathy realizes is that two men in Kilts
speaking with deep Scottish accents are argueing their
sexual prowess. Afraid they may accost her to settle their
debate, Kathy takes a can of mousse out of her bag and
sprays the duo on their love guns. As the twosome flee
from their attacker, a third Scot appears who is not afraid
of the mousse because he noticed that some safely landed on
Kathy. Ian Ross introduces himself as THE PLEASURE
MASTER. He explains he is in competition with his two
brothers, who just fled from Kathy's wrath, over who is The
King of Sex. Kathy is even more stunned when he proves to
her that it is 1542. As Ian turns up the seduction, Kathy
begins to fall in love, but to his amazement so does Ian
because for the first time since he began pleasuring women,
a female cares how he feels. THE PLEASURE MASTER is a wild, amusing and often-
satirical time travel romance that stars two wonderful
lovers and a fabulous magical matchmaker. The story line
is hilarious as the competition between the brothers heats
up the pages almost as much as the relationship between
Kathy and Ian does. As she did with AN ORIGINAL SIN, Nina
Bangs commits sub-genre heresy by adding humor and irony to
a torrid historical romance. Harriet Klausner
